Transaction 64b28b56120771652e69c88e2600845c483793fd44b96e4fca441c75991ac160
1 Input
1 Output
-
64b28b56120771652e69c88e2600845c483793fd44b96e4fca441c75991ac160:0
- value
- 244563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24bb9d12e11e7fa7fd2152115d9a7277e3c68f6a OP_EQUAL
- address
- 353F14xHbiKw1xqfMRkv6kUAZHLGompaDn